Ravensview Real Estate & Houses for Sale
The character of Ravensview is exemplified by its relaxed ambience. Ravensview is very quiet overall, as the streets tend to be very peaceful. Parks aren't well-spread out, making it rather challenging to get to them from the majority of locations within the neighbourhood. Despite that, there are a few green spaces nearby for residents to check out.
Transportation
This area is an extremely good part of Kingston for getting around by car. It is very convenient to park. This neighbourhood is not very appropriate for cycling since the topography is not especially flat, and there are very few bike lanes. A majority of the homes for sale in this part of Kingston are located in places that are also not very suitable for pedestrians because running daily errands is very impractical without a vehicle.
Housing
Roughly 95% of the population of this neighbourhood own their home whereas renters make up the remainder. Single detached homes are the most common housing type, representing almost all dwellings in this area. Around 30% of properties in this part of the city were built between 1960 and 1980, while many of the remaining buildings were constructed pre-1960 and in the 1980s. There is a higher proportion of four or more bedroom homes in this part of Kingston.
Services
Buying one's groceries very often demands the use of a vehicle in Ravensview. As far as education is concerned, this part of Kingston does not have any high schools or primary schools. Furthermore, it can be very hard to reach daycares without a vehicle.
